Wow I wish I can get mine that glossy. What wax did you use? Nice!

I had my own detail shop for about year....so I have some experience.

Car was hand washed thoroughly - paint then rubbed down with microfiber rag soaked with Brakleen (simple solvent to remove road oil)

Porter Cable orbital polisher used with Menzerna Final Polish - then moose wax. All products came from Scott @ Automotive Specialty - he is a vendor in the show and shine area here on SVTP.
